Answered: Why Is My Apple ID Sign Out Unavailable Due to Restrictions?
Why can't I sign out of my Apple ID account? There are several possible reasons for this issue.
► Reason 1. If the Sign Out button on your iPhone is gray and it says “cannot sign out due to restrictions”, check if Screen Time is enabled on your iPhone. Enabling this option will prevent you from signing out of your Apple ID while Screen Time is on.
► Reason 2. If your Apple ID is used for iCloud services (such as iCloud Backup, iCloud Drive, or Find My iPhone), you may need to disable these services before you can sign out of your device.
► Reason 3. If your Find My iPhone is turned on, you may need to disable it before you can sign out of your Apple ID. It's a security feature designed to protect your account and device.

Tip 1. Disable Screen Time on iPhone to Sign Out Apple ID
Screen Time is a setting on your iOS device that manages usage time and controls features. However, sometimes this feature may prevent you from signing out of your Apple ID. If you have Screen Time turned on, the Sign Out button will be grayed out.
The solution is easy, just follow the steps below to turn Screen Time off.
Step 1. On your iPhone, go to the Settings app > Scroll down and tap Screen Time.
Step 2. Locate and tap Turn Off Screen Time (Or Turn Off App & Website Activity in iOS 17 and later).
Step 3. If you have set up a passcode for Screen Time, enter it to access your choice. And you’d better Turn off Screen Time passcode either.

Step 5. After disabling Screen Time, try signing out of your Apple ID again.
Step 6. Go to Settings > Tap on your Apple ID name > Click Sign Out from the page > Enter your Apple ID password.
Tip 2. How to Remove iPhone Screen Time without Password
If you forget your Screen Time passcode, you can also turn it off using your Apple ID password, provided you've linked your accounts before and didn't skip providing your Apple ID. Open Settings > Screen Time > Change Screen Time Passcode > Forgot Passcode? > Then you can establish a new passcode.

Tip 3. Disable iCloud Services and Find My iPhone
Additionally, turning on iCloud services and Find My iPhone can prevent you from logging out of your Apple ID. Disabling these features may help resolve the issue.
Here are steps to disable Find My iPhone.
Step 1. Go to Settings on your device.
Step 2. Click [Your Name] > Select Find My > Tap Find My iPhone.
Step 3. On this page, toggle the Find My iPhone button off.
Step 4. After that, try again to see if you can sign out of your Apple ID.
If you have iCloud Backup or other iCloud services enabled, make sure to disable them as well.

Question 1. Will Sign Out of Apple ID/Apple Account Delete Data?
Signing out of your Apple ID usually does not delete any data from your device. However, it may affect your access to iCloud services and other Apple features. For example, your iCloud data (photos, contacts, notes, calendars, documents, etc.) will no longer be synced between your devices, but will remain on your devices.

Question 3. How do I get rid of Apple ID verification failed on my iPhone?
The "Apple ID Verification Failed" error can be caused by a variety of issues, such as network problems, outdated iOS versions, or Apple ID issues.
You can try the following:
- Check your Internet connection
- Check Apple System Status
- Sign out and sign back in to your Apple ID.
- Update iOS
- Reset Network Settings
If the problem persists, contact Apple Support for further troubleshooting.
